Essex County Chess

Essex teams play in the County Championships for chess players of a wide range of standards to compete against opponents of similar playing strengths, initially from other Southern Counties and, if a qualifying place is secured, nationally. Any player who does not have a published rating can be allocated a tournament rating by the respective championships controllers on the submission of an indication of playing strength. Matches for teams of 12 or 16 players are usually played with a 4½ or 5 hour playing session on a Saturday afternoon.

Eligibility conditions for representing Essex are any one of:

(i) Birth in the County;
(ii) Five years’ residence in the County at any time;
(iii) Two months immediate previous and present membership of a club either in or affiliated to the County;
(iv) One month’s immediately previous and present residence in the County;
(v) Present attendance as a student at a school, college or university in the County.

The boundaries of Essex are defined in the west by the River Lea, in the north by the River Stour and in the south by the River Thames.

For 2026-27 Essex has once more entered four teams in the SCCU Counties Championships, under each of the rating-limited sections: U2050, U1850, U1650 and U1450. The SCCU Championship is a qualifier for the ECF national stage.

Once again,there was insufficient support to run an Open team, so only the rating-limited sections have been entered.

Aggregate statistics – Website Trophy

The Website Trophy is awarded to the player with the highest score from matches for the County, embracing all matches played in the Season.

Website Trophy conditions: The Website Trophy shall be awarded to the player with the highest aggregate score in matches for the County and is open for annual competition. All games played for the County, from the first SCCU match to the last ECF stage match, count towards the trophy. Points gained by default during a match count as if gained by play over-the-board, provided that the player travelled to and was present at the match . Default points conceded by the opposition in advance, including whole match concessions, for which the player(s) were not required to travel, do not count towards the trophy. In the event that two or more players tie for the same highest total at the end of the season, the player with the higher percentage performance (i.e. having gained his/her points from fewer appearances) will be awarded the trophy. Should two or more players have the same highest score and identical performance percentage, the trophy shall be shared.
